Output ddc23a5cbc434d49259c7d8606a0dbd61956a8ecf6bf4d75df04947cd598c3d7:1

value
3442139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d9ff1b31a5b381e20d7250b09b389a27958f4f OP_EQUAL
address
3CAJ75Kr7ywnxvH95rnfzpCHHLbbfhXYVg
transaction
ddc23a5cbc434d49259c7d8606a0dbd61956a8ecf6bf4d75df04947cd598c3d7
spent
true